priceless

PRYS-lihs
adj
1
So valuable that no price could be put on it.
"The museum houses several priceless works of art."
"Her advice during that difficult time was priceless."
2
Extremely funny or absurd.
"The look on his face when he realised his mistake was priceless."

Etymology

From price + -less ("lacking, without").
